Kislev evenings are getting chillier - and Chef Austin’s chestnut gnocchi with mushrooms is the perfect comforting dish to try. It's pillowy (not chewy!), umami-packed, and so good, he’s thinking it might make the menu.
Get the recipe:
Dough
1 (2.2-pound) bag Tuscanini All-Purpose Flour (about 8 and 1/3 cups)
2 and 1/4 cups cold water
1 teaspoon Haddar Kosher Salt
